S01E08: Kaddu Bomb
A terrorist is setting a bomb to blast in the city. The bomb is set inside a pumpkin. The terrorists assistant takes the pumpkin to the market, where she meets and befriends Pandey. The assistant gives him the pumpkin inside a bag, and then disappears. When Pandey gets back to the police station, Chandramukhi tells him that she had received information that a terrorist is planting a bomb inside a pumpkin. This is when Pandey realizes that the pumpkin he is holding is none other than the bomb. The bomb experts are nowhere around. What are the police going to do now?
Overview
F.I.R. is an Indian television sitcom first shown on July 31, 2006, on SAB TV. It is a story about a Haryanvi Lady Police Inspector. The story revolves around her and her sub- constables antics. The show is produced by Edit II Productions and is being broadcast Monday to Friday nights. The sitcom was nominated for the Best Sitcom category at the Indian Telly Awards in 2009. The sitcom is set in a police station.
On March 16, 2013, the show took a 20-year leap from 2013 to 2033 but from 8 July 2013, the setting has returned to the present.
